FACTS  AND  FORMULAE  FOR  SIMPLIFICATION  QUESTIONS

 

 

1. BODMAS Rule: This rule depicts the correct sequence in which the operations are to be executed,so as to find out the value of a given expression. Here, 'B' stands for bracket , 'O' for of , 'D' for division and 'M' for multiplication, 'A' for addition and 'S' for subtraction.

Thus, in simplifying an expression, first of all the brackets must be removed, strictly in the order(), {} and [].

After removing the brackets, we must use the following operations strictly in the order:

(1) of    (2)division   (3) multiplication   (4)addition   (5)subtraction.

 Modulus of a real number : Modulus of a real number a is defined as |a| = aif a>0-aif a<0

 

2. Virnaculum (or bar) : When an expression contains Virnaculum, before applying the ‘BODMAS’ rule, we simplify the expression under the Virnaculum.
